Abaqus热源子程序:双椭球模型的实现与应用

版权申诉
5星 · 超过95%的资源 6 下载量 112 浏览量 更新于2024-11-02 收藏 1KB ZIP 举报
资源摘要信息: "双椭球热源子程序" 是在 ABAQUS 软件环境下,用 Fortran 语言编写的用于模拟激光热处理、焊接过程等涉及热传导问题的子程序。此程序特别设计为描述双椭球模型的热源分布,该模型能够较为准确地反映实际加工过程中的热输入情况。 知识点详细说明: 1. ABAQUS软件:ABAQUS是广泛应用于工程领域的非线性有限元分析软件,由美国Dassault Systemes公司开发。它能够模拟各种复杂的实际问题,包括结构、热传导、流体以及多物理场耦合问题。ABAQUS软件在工业界和学术界都具有极高的认可度和应用价值。 2. Fortran语言:Fortran是一种高级编程语言,广泛用于数值计算和科学计算领域。它拥有高效的数据处理能力和强大的数值计算能力,非常适合于编写科学计算和工程仿真程序,如ABAQUS的用户子程序。 3. 热源子程序:在ABAQUS中,热源子程序是一种用户自定义程序,允许用户根据特定问题定义复杂的热源模型。通过编写Fortran代码,可以实现对热源分布、热输入功率以及热流模式的详细控制,从而对实际物理过程进行仿真。 4. 双椭球热源模型:双椭球热源模型是一种用于描述激光或电弧焊接热源分布的数学模型。该模型将热源分为前半部分和后半部分,各自具有不同的椭球形状。前半部分通常比后半部分集中,这样的模型能够更精确地模拟焊缝形成过程中的熔池形状和热影响区的热分布情况。 5. 激光热处理与焊接过程仿真:在材料加工领域,激光热处理和焊接过程是两种对材料性能产生显著影响的工艺。通过仿真这些过程,可以优化工艺参数,预测材料响应,减少试错成本,并提高产品质量。双椭球热源子程序提供了一种高精度的仿真工具,帮助工程师更好地理解和控制热输入的影响。 6. 非线性有限元分析:ABAQUS的非线性分析能力是其核心特色之一。非线性分析涉及到材料非线性、几何非线性和接触非线性等问题。热源子程序在这个背景下尤为重要,因为它涉及到复杂的热力学行为和材料响应。 7. 子程序使用与编写:在ABAQUS中,子程序的使用允许用户对仿真模型进行高度自定义。编写子程序需要对Fortran语言有深入理解,同时也需要对ABAQUS的仿真流程和数据结构有充分的了解。编写出的子程序需要嵌入到ABAQUS的主程序中,通过数据交换与主程序配合完成仿真任务。 8. 双椭圆程序(for)文件:作为资源文件,"双椭圆程序.for"是一个用Fortran语言编写的文件。这个文件包含了实现双椭球热源模型的关键算法和数据处理逻辑。在ABAQUS仿真中调用该子程序,可以实现对焊接或激光热处理过程中热源分布的详细模拟。 总结以上知识点,"双椭球热源子程序"是ABAQUS环境下,用Fortran语言编写的专门用于模拟激光焊接或热处理过程的热源分布模型。通过该子程序,可以更精确地预测材料在热输入下的温度分布和热影响区的形状,对于工程设计和工艺优化具有重要意义。掌握该子程序的编写和应用,需要扎实的编程技能和对ABAQUS仿真流程的深入理解。